Transaction 43f81e62a939c8d61ea449e03cc7450264dc49a16ceac208ecd583a9735d3d27

1 Input
2 Outputs
  • 43f81e62a939c8d61ea449e03cc7450264dc49a16ceac208ecd583a9735d3d27:0
  • value  68398
    address  3GtsZBF3hPFWywZBSCa1snZHZyAc9V6v8C
  • 43f81e62a939c8d61ea449e03cc7450264dc49a16ceac208ecd583a9735d3d27:1
  • value  399694
    address  bc1qhhuua8jk7lp2fdaf0dk33ylwnglqk4cah4lx48